changeset 1528:e581df3c99e4

6882559: new JEditorPane("text/plain","") fails for null context class loader Reviewed-by: serb, aivanov
author mcherkas
date Tue, 06 Dec 2016 12:50:50 +0000
parents c3e8ac70542b
children 8eea54ce9005
files src/share/classes/javax/swing/JEditorPane.java test/javax/swing/JEditorPane/6882559/bug6882559.java
diffstat 2 files changed, 173 insertions(+), 3 deletions(-) [+]
line wrap: on
line diff
--- a/src/share/classes/javax/swing/JEditorPane.java	Mon Dec 05 17:32:29 2016 +0000
+++ b/src/share/classes/javax/swing/JEditorPane.java	Tue Dec 06 12:50:50 2016 +0000
@@ -1242,7 +1242,7 @@
         if (k == null) {
             // try to dynamically load the support
             String classname = getKitTypeRegistry().get(type);
-            ClassLoader loader = getKitLoaderRegistry().get(type);
+            ClassLoader loader = getKitLoaderRegistry().get(type).orElse(null);
             try {
                 Class c;
                 if (loader != null) {
@@ -1299,7 +1299,7 @@
      */
     public static void registerEditorKitForContentType(String type, String classname, ClassLoader loader) {
         getKitTypeRegistry().put(type, classname);
-        getKitLoaderRegistry().put(type, loader);
+        getKitLoaderRegistry().put(type, Optional.ofNullable(loader));
         getKitRegisty().remove(type);
     }
 
@@ -1320,7 +1320,7 @@
         return (Hashtable)SwingUtilities.appContextGet(kitTypeRegistryKey);
     }
 
-    private static Hashtable<String, ClassLoader> getKitLoaderRegistry() {
+    private static Hashtable<String, Optional<ClassLoader>> getKitLoaderRegistry() {
         loadDefaultKitsIfNecessary();
         return (Hashtable)SwingUtilities.appContextGet(kitLoaderRegistryKey);
     }

+    private static final class Optional<T> {
+        /**
+         * Common instance for {@code empty()}.
+         */
+        private static final Optional<?> EMPTY = new Optional<Object>();
+
+        /**
+         * If non-null, the value; if null, indicates no value is present
+         */
+        private final T value;
+
+        /**
+         * Constructs an empty instance.
+         *
+         * @implNote Generally only one empty instance, {@link Optional#EMPTY},
+         * should exist per VM.
+         */
+        private Optional() {
+            this.value = null;
+        }
+
+        /**
+         * Returns an empty {@code Optional} instance.  No value is present for this
+         * Optional.
+         *
+         * @apiNote Though it may be tempting to do so, avoid testing if an object
+         * is empty by comparing with {@code ==} against instances returned by
+         * {@code Option.empty()}. There is no guarantee that it is a singleton.
+         * Instead, use {@link #isPresent()}.
+         *
+         * @param <T> Type of the non-existent value
+         * @return an empty {@code Optional}
+         */
+        public static<T> Optional<T> empty() {
+            @SuppressWarnings("unchecked")
+                Optional<T> t = (Optional<T>) EMPTY;
+            return t;
+        }
+
+        /**
+         * Constructs an instance with the value present.
+         *
+         * @param value the non-null value to be present
+         * @throws NullPointerException if value is null
+         */
+        private Optional(T value) {
+            this.value = requireNonNull(value);
+        }
+
+        /**
+         * Returns an {@code Optional} with the specified present non-null value.
+         *
+         * @param <T> the class of the value
+         * @param value the value to be present, which must be non-null
+         * @return an {@code Optional} with the value present
+         * @throws NullPointerException if value is null
+         */
+        public static <T> Optional<T> of(T value) {
+            return new Optional<T>(value);
+        }
+
+        /**
+         * Returns an {@code Optional} describing the specified value, if non-null,
+         * otherwise returns an empty {@code Optional}.
+         *
+         * @param <T> the class of the value
+         * @param value the possibly-null value to describe
+         * @return an {@code Optional} with a present value if the specified value
+         * is non-null, otherwise an empty {@code Optional}
+         */
+        public static <T> Optional<T> ofNullable(T value) {
+            if (value == null) {
+                return empty();
+            } else {
+                return of(value);
+            }
+        }
+
+        /**
+         * If a value is present in this {@code Optional}, returns the value,
+         * otherwise throws {@code NoSuchElementException}.
+         *
+         * @return the non-null value held by this {@code Optional}
+         * @throws NoSuchElementException if there is no value present
+         *
+         * @see Optional#isPresent()
+         */
+        public T get() {
+            if (value == null) {
+                throw new NoSuchElementException("No value present");
+            }
+            return value;
+        }
+
+        /**
+         * Return the value if present, otherwise return {@code other}.
+         *
+         * @param other the value to be returned if there is no value present, may
+         * be null
+         * @return the value, if present, otherwise {@code other}
+         */
+        public T orElse(T other) {
+            return value != null ? value : other;
+        }
+
+        /**
+	 * Checks that the specified object reference is not {@code null}. This
+	 * method is designed primarily for doing parameter validation in methods
+	 * and constructors, as demonstrated below:
+	 * <blockquote><pre>
+	 * public Foo(Bar bar) {
+	 *     this.bar = Objects.requireNonNull(bar);
+	 * }
+	 * </pre></blockquote>
+	 *
+	 * @param obj the object reference to check for nullity
+	 * @param <T> the type of the reference
+	 * @return {@code obj} if not {@code null}
+	 * @throws NullPointerException if {@code obj} is {@code null}
+	 */
+	private static <T> T requireNonNull(T obj) {
+	    if (obj == null)
+		throw new NullPointerException();
+	    return obj;
+	}
+    }

+/* @test
+   @bug 6882559
+   @summary new JEditorPane("text/plain","") fails for null context class loader
+   @author Mikhail Cherkasov
+   @run main bug6882559
+*/
+
+import javax.swing.*;
+
+
+public class bug6882559 {
+    public static void main(String[] args) throws Exception {
+        SwingUtilities.invokeAndWait(new Runnable() {
+                public void run() {
+                    Thread.currentThread().setContextClassLoader(null);
+                    new javax.swing.JEditorPane("text/plain", "");
+                }
+        });
+    }
+}
